Gyu-Kaku has always been one of my go-to BBQ spots in San Francisco-especially for their unlimited BBQ options. It's a place I've visited countless times with family, & I've always loved the experience. So when I found out they had a location in Montreal, I was genuinely excited to try it & even brought along a friend who had never been before. I really wanted him to experience how good it can be.
Unfortunately, from the very beginning, the experience felt completely different. The service was noticeably lacking-it took multiple attempts just to get the staff's attention for basic things, which already set the tone for the evening.
I went ahead & ordered my usual favorite items, but the portions here seemed smaller or different compared to what I'm used to in San Francisco. I understand there could be differences in sourcing or pricing, so I was willing to give that the benefit of the doubt. However, what was harder to overlook was the quality of certain cuts-especially the yaki shabu beef. It was so thin & inconsistent that it felt almost like minced meat, & a lot of it kept falling through the grill, making it frustrating to cook & enjoy.
On top of that, the grill itself wasn't functioning properly. The heat distribution was uneven-some parts would burn the meat instantly while others barely cooked it, leaving pieces raw. For a place centered around BBQ, this really impacted the overall experience.
It honestly felt like a completely different restaurant compared to the San Francisco locations I'm used to, which was disappointing-especially since I had hyped it up to my friend.
If I had to highlight one positive, it would be the lava cake. It was actually better than the one I've had in San Francisco-rich, warm, & perfectly done. But realistically, you don't go to a BBQ restaurant just for dessert.
Overall, I'm quite disappointed to say that this visit didn't live up to my expectations, & it's not a spot I'd return to in Montreal the way I do back in San Francisco.
